A few years ago, Denisa, our co-founder, was leading a private tour when the guests mentioned almost in passing that a family member had served in the Second World War. His name, they believed, was recorded in the American Roll of Honour at St Paul’s Cathedral — a book listing the names of around 28,000 American servicemen and women who died while stationed in Britain and Europe.

St Paul’s wasn’t on the itinerary. They were simply passing it. But Denisa took them in, spoke with a volunteer, and they were allowed to view the book. They found the name. The guests were stunned.

That moment is impossible to plan. It happened because the tour was private, because the guide was paying attention, and because there was no fixed script to stick to. No group tour, audio guide, or app could have created it.

What Does a Private Tour Guide in London Actually Do?

There are three things a private Blue Badge guide gives you that no independent visit can replicate.

First: Access, our Blue Badge guides, who complete a rigorous two-year training programme and extensive examinations in history, art, architecture, and more, are the only external guides permitted to lead tours inside attractions like the Tower of London, Westminster Abbey, and the British Museum. Most guides in London walk you to the door and wait outside. Ours walk in with you and actually guide you!

Second: Less time queuing, more time looking. London’s busiest attractions can mean significant waiting times on a busy morning. Pre-booked tickets and a guide who knows which entrance to use, and when, changes the shape of your entire day. As one guest, Kimberly, put it: “Ben guided us through the crowds and made our visit so enjoyable.” That’s not luck. It’s experience.

Third: the stories. You can stand in front of the Coronation Chair at Westminster Abbey and read the information panel. Or you can have someone explain why a 700-year-old piece of furniture sat at the centre of British royal history all the way through to King Charles III’s coronation in 2023 — and why it matters. All of our guides are Blue Badge qualified, but we only work with the best storytellers. The difference between seeing something and understanding it is usually a great storyteller.

Why Exploring London on Your Own Can Be Harder Than You Think

We hear this a lot from guests after they’ve tried to explore independently: they spent half the day staring at their phones. Finding the next location, checking opening times, reading about what they were looking at, trying to work out the best route, and figure out how the Underground works.

London is a big, complex city. Navigation alone takes up mental energy that could be spent actually enjoying where you are. A guide handles all of that. The result is a day where you’re present rather than problem-solving.

Our reviews are full of people who had previously tried to do it themselves and noticed the difference immediately. When you don’t have to think about logistics, you absorb far more of what you’re seeing.

 

The planning problem starts before you land

Most visitors don’t just struggle with logistics on the day. They struggle with them for weeks beforehand. Which attractions can you realistically fit into one morning? What’s closed on Sundays? Does it make sense to visit the Tower of London and Westminster Abbey on the same day, or are they too far apart? Is there enough time to get from the British Museum to a 2 pm timed entry across the city?

When You Don't Need a Private Tour Guide in London

We want to be honest here, because we think it builds more trust than a blanket sales pitch.

If your ideal day in London is moving quickly from landmark to landmark, taking a photo at each one, and then moving on, a private guide is probably more than you need. Our tours are built around depth, not volume. The guests who get the most from them are those who want to understand what they’re looking at, not just document that they were there.

We call it checklist tourism, and it’s completely valid. But it’s not what we do. If that’s your style, there are excellent self-guided options that will serve you better.
